Output 7528b88bdf47c8e1cb2a314e659384c924c382a8e1ab23999df174ccc605fc1c:0

value
8247117
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20b3695f7e5e9bf9cd279e3e33a651075628416b OP_EQUAL
address
34fvURJLTvptryPU1K3Bj5mx1E2orddvxY
transaction
7528b88bdf47c8e1cb2a314e659384c924c382a8e1ab23999df174ccc605fc1c
spent
true